Abstract

Apparatus and method for rendering an image of a fibrous material. The method includes providing parametric fibrous material optical properties derived from actual material fiber samples via the apparatus; providing a parametric virtual light environment; providing a virtual fibrous material array; and rendering an image of the virtual fibrous material array according to the interaction of the parametric fibrous material properties and the parametric virtual light environment.

Claims (11)

1. An apparatus for determining material optical properties, the apparatus comprising:

a. a material holder comprising a curvilinear surface;

b. a collimated light source disposed in alignment with a surface normal of the curvilinear surface, to illuminate the material holder, wherein the collimated light source has an output; and

c. an image capture element aligned with the collimated light source and the surface normal of the curvilinear surface of the material holder;

wherein an angular offset between an axis of the collimated light source and an axis of the image capture element, each in a plane of the surface normal of the curvilinear surface of the material holder, is less than about 5 degrees; and

wherein a surface mirror and a half silvered mirror are disposed to bring the output of the collimated light source into alignment with the axis of the image capture element and to illuminate an image capture surface.

2. The apparatus according to claim 1 wherein the material holder further comprises a fiber separator.

3. The apparatus according to claim 1 wherein the angular offset is less than about 3 degrees.

4. The apparatus according to claim 1 wherein the collimated light source is aligned within about 0.2 degrees of the surface normal of the curvilinear surface of the material holder.

5. The apparatus according to claim 1 wherein the image capture element is aligned within about 0.2 degrees of the surface normal of the curvilinear surface of the material holder.

6. The apparatus according to claim 1 wherein at least one of the axis of the collimated light source and the axis of the image capture element is aligned to within about 2.5 degree to an axis normal to the curvilinear surface of the material holder.
